A cold joint occurs when new concrete is poured against concrete that has already begun to harden, preventing a proper chemical bond between the layers . This discontinuity creates a plane of weakness, reducing the monolithic strength of the structure and potentially acting as a stress concentration point . Cold joints are often visible as lines or seams on the surface, sometimes with color differences or jagged edges .
